Asbestos roof removal disposal methods and procedures are critical for guaranteeing each safety and compliance with regulations. The presence of asbestos in roofing materials necessitates relevant precautions and issues during the removal course of. Given its hazardous properties, asbestos requires specialized dealing with to stop health dangers to staff and residents alike.


The initial step within the asbestos roof removal process entails a radical inspection. Professionals assess the situation of the roofing materials containing asbestos and determine the extent of the contamination. This assessment helps determine the best strategy for removal and disposal. Proper identification is essential, because it guides all subsequent actions referring to safety protocols and regulatory compliance.

Once the materials have been surveyed, planning for secure removal begins (Safe Asbestos Removal Sydney). A detailed plan is drafted that encompasses procedures for handling the asbestos safely. This plan consists of deciding on applicable private protecting equipment for workers, securing the work website, and speaking risks to anyone in the vicinity. It's crucial to stick to guidelines established by regulatory our bodies such because the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) or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A).

Before initiating the removal itself, a containment area is established. Barriers have to be erected to forestall the unfold of asbestos fibers during the process. This containment zone ought to be outfitted with adverse air stress techniques to additional restrict any potential contamination. Warning indicators should be posted prominently, alerting everybody to the presence of hazardous materials.


During the actual removal, employees wear specialized protective gear, including respirators, disposable coveralls, and gloves. The materials are handled gently to attenuate the discharge of fibers. Asbestos-containing materials must be wetted down earlier than being disturbed to assist stop airborne particles. Careful methods, such as removing whole sections rather than breaking materials into smaller pieces, are key to maintaining a secure environment.


Once the roofing materials are eliminated, they should be packaged accurately for disposal. Specific waste containers designed for asbestos disposal are utilized to make sure containment of the hazardous material. These containers must be adequately labeled and sealed to convey the character of the waste. Strict guidelines define the way to seal and dispose of these materials to mitigate any potential health impacts.

Transporting the asbestos waste requires adherence to stringent regulations. Only licensed contractors or automobiles designated for hazardous waste are permitted for this transport. The waste is often taken to specialised disposal websites which are approved to handle asbestos. Facilities are geared up to manage such materials safely, ensuring that they don't pose a threat to the setting or public health.




After transportation, given the hazardous nature of asbestos, the receiving facility must preserve stringent protocols for managing the disposed materials. The facility will often have a process that entails high-temperature incineration or safe landfilling, specifically designed to mitigate risks related to asbestos. Documentation concerning the transport and disposal process can also be essential; information must be saved to path the waste from removal to final disposal.


In addition to quick disposal strategies, there are various protective measures employed throughout and after removal. Regular air monitoring checks are applied to ensure that asbestos fibers do not turn out to be airborne. This monitoring may be important in assessing the effectiveness of containment methods and the general safety of the environment as quickly as the removal is accomplished.


Post-removal clean-up is also an important step. Professional cleansing crews skilled particularly in hazardous material dealing with are usually engaged to conduct thorough decontamination of the worksite. They make use of specialised equipment and techniques to make certain that all debris and potential asbestos fibers are eradicated.

  • Ensure correct identification of asbestos-containing materials before commencing removal procedures to avoid security hazards.

  • Establish a delegated containment space around the worksite to forestall the spread of asbestos fibers throughout removal.

  • Use acceptable personal protecting equipment (PPE), including respirators, disposable coveralls, and gloves, to guard workers from exposure.

  • Employ moist removal techniques by saturating materials with water or a wetting agent to attenuate airborne asbestos particles.

  • Carefully take away asbestos roofing materials using hand tools to keep away from breakage and launch of fibers into the air.

  • Implement negative air strain techniques to filter and ventilate the work area, decreasing the chance of contamination.

  • Properly label and seal asbestos waste in approved, leak-tight containers to ensure protected transportation and disposal.

  • Follow native, state, and federal regulations for transporting asbestos waste to authorized disposal sites, making certain compliance all through the method.

  • Conduct air monitoring before, during, and after removal to evaluate the effectiveness of containment measures and guarantee security.

Are there options to removing an asbestos roof?undefinedEncapsulation and sealing the prevailing roof may be viable alternate options. These strategies contain making use of a sealant to prevent fiber release but should only be considered if the roof is in good condition and not damaged.


What health risks are associated with asbestos exposure during roof removal?undefinedAsbestos exposure can lead to serious health issues, including lung cancer, mesothelioma, and asbestosis. These risks increase with the duration and intensity of publicity, making safety protocols during removal crucial.
